Exploring Advanced Control Techniques
The course delves into several advanced topics, including nonlinear control, robust control, and adaptive control. Nonlinear control systems are essential for handling systems that do not follow simple linear relationships, which is common in many real-world applications. Robust control techniques ensure that systems can operate effectively even under varying conditions and uncertainties. Adaptive control, on the other hand, allows systems to adjust their behavior based on changing conditions, making them highly versatile and reliable.
